Division II Meet Preview Queens Looks To Rebound Against Wingate

Coming off a tough loss to Division III powerhouse Emory last weekend, defending National Champions Queens University of Charlotte will be looking to rebound against fellow Division II school Wingate University. Take a look below to see meet previews for some of the biggest Division II match-ups this week!

Coming off a tough loss on both sides to the Emory Eagles last weekend, defending NCAA Champions Queens University will be looking to rebound with a good meet against Wingate. Based off last years result, this will be no easy. The Royal women prevailed only 132-119, while the Royal men won by a mere seven points, 129-122.

Making matters more complicated, Wingate hasn’t had a competition yet this year. Their opening meet against St. Andrews was postponed due to Hurricane Matthew, which may mean there are some surprises in store for the Royals. For the Bulldog women, they will look at a trio of seniors to lead the way, including backstroker Vika Arkhipova, breaststroker Jessika Weiss, and sprinter Caitlin Coughlin. The Lady Bulldogs won the 200 medley and 400 medley relays en route to national records at NCAA’s last year, and although they will be hurt by the loss of butterflier Armony Dumur expect them to try and start with a win in the opening relay and hang on to that momentum. On the men’s side, Wingate will be looking to senior Leif-Henning Kluever and transfer Sebastian Holmberg to grab some individual wins while they challenge on the relays.
